Senior Occupational Hygienist/Environmental Consultant (LAA)

We are proud to be partnering with one of Western Australia's most established and well-respected environmental consultancies, known for their technical depth, responsiveness, and long-standing client relationships across the industrial, government, and resource sectors.

This privately-owned consultancy has carved out a strong niche in occupational hygiene, hazardous materials, contaminated land, and risk management services. Their growing Perth team is now seeking an experienced Senior Occupational Hygienist / Environmental Consultant (LAA) to step into a diverse and rewarding role-delivering fieldwork, technical reporting, and client-facing advisory services across a wide range of projects.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and conduct hazardous materials surveys (asbestos, lead, mould, etc.) and indoor air quality assessments.

  • Deliver occupational hygiene monitoring and risk assessments in line with national legislation and industry best practices.

  • Provide expert advice and tailored solutions to clients across mining, infrastructure, education, and commercial sectors.

  • Prepare clear, concise, and regulatory-compliant technical reports.

  • Mentor junior consultants and contribute to team capability building.

  • Maintain your Licensed Asbestos Assessor (LAA) accreditation and uphold high standards of safety and compliance.

What You Bring:

  • 5+ years of relevant industry experience, preferably within an environmental or OHSE consultancy.

  • WA Licensed Asbestos Assessor (LAA).

  • Tertiary qualifications in Occupational Hygiene, Environmental Science, or a related field.

  • Strong technical knowledge of hazardous materials and occupational hygiene regulations.

  • Comfortable with both field-based and office-based work.

  • Excellent client communication and project management skills.
